**About the Office of the Comptroller**

The Office of the Comptroller ensures that the more than $50 billion in annual transactions authorized by the general appropriations act and supplemental appropriations are executed in accordance with all statutory requirements and recorded in compliance with accounting standards. We also oversee capital assets, federal funding inflows, and other transactions. We also own and maintain statewide payments and payroll systems, safeguarding critical financial information. We operate in support of our partners, the financial staff at more than 150 departments and agencies across the Commonwealth.

As stewards of the public trust, CTR aspires to inspire confidence by maintaining our core principles: clarity, integrity, and accountability.

The powers and obligations of the Office of the Comptroller are generally dictated by M.G.L. c. 7A.

**Position** **Summary**

The Office of the Comptroller seeks an Operations Coordinator, reporting to the Director of Facilities. The Operations Coordinator is a member of the CTR Facilities Team, which is part of the CTR’s Executive and Administration Team, and provides support on all facilities operations functions, including but not limited to equipment and consumable supply inventory, records management and digitization, front desk coverage, organization of office work areas, and on-boarding and off-boarding support.

**Specific** **Duties**

The specific duties of this position include but are not limited to the following:

- Work as the key point of contact for CTR Inventory including tracking and maintaining inventory for all CTR’s Teams.
- Support the CTR’s ongoing record digitization effort including review and organize documents prior to scanning; assist with tracking documents through the scanning process; prepare documents for scanning; group documents by data elements for scanning; scan documents; verify and validate that scanned image is accurate and matches paper files; re-file scanned documents in an organized manner to prepare for final disposition of paper documents.
- Front desk coverage includes greeting in-person visitors; answering and triaging telephone calls; receiving packages; validating packing slip materials; and delivering to proper location.
- Assisting the Director of Facilities and Chief Financial Officer (CFO) in maintaining an organized workplace including supply areas to maximize efficiencies, reduce costs and eliminate waste.
- Provide back-up support to other CTR Facilities team members as needed to ensure business continuity.
- Work with colleagues at various levels, as part of a team to advance Facilities projects, identify best practices, and help develop procedures.
- Actively assist CTR Leadership with cross training, knowledge transfer, disaster recovery, risk assessment and internal control review.
- Maintain awareness of and compliance with all CTR operating policies and procedures.
- Remain current with CTR policies and procedures, read CTR memos, updates, attend annual internal control, risk, and fraud prevention trainings.
- Immediately raise concerns, requests or potential errors or issues to the attention of your supervisor, manager, or director.
- Contribute to the overall CTR work environment in a positive, respectful, and cooperative fashion.
- All employees of CTR may be asked to engage in other assignments on an as needed basis.

**Bargaining Unit / Salary Range** NAGE Unit 6 / Grade 10: $61,195.94 - $88,071.36

Salary range is per the Unit 6 Collective Bargaining Agreement between the Commonwealth of Massachusetts and the National Association of Government Employees. This position is an Operations Coordinator/Program Coordinator I Grade 10. Salary is determined in accordance with the collective bargaining agreement and Commonwealth hiring guidelines.
